Winklevoss Twins Rejects CFTC’s New Proposed Rule Against Event Contracts, Says Proposal to be Struck Down by Courts

2024-08-11No Comments2 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Gemini co-founders Tyler and Cameron Winklevoss are criticizing the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) for proposing a new rule against event contracts.

In a new thread on the social media platform X, Tyler Winklevoss say that the regulatory body should withdraw its new proposed guidelines because it would deny U.S. citizens access to event contracts, or futures contracts that provide “yes” or “no” options for the outcomes of events such as elections, games or developments.

“The CFTC should withdraw its proposed rule on event contracts, which would categorically ban all event contracts in the US, such as those traded on Polymarket, the world’s largest prediction market. Americans should not be denied access to these powerful markets.”

According to Cameron Winklevoss, decentralized prediction markets are important because they “provide valuable information about future events that is rooted in financial accountability.” The billionaire continues participation that the CFTC’s proposed rule will be rejected by the court due to the Supreme Court’s latest ruling.

“There is nothing thoughtful about a blanket ban on markets that have been used in one form or another for decades and have proven to be extremely reliable tools for predicting future events…

This proposed rule, if adopted, will be rejected by the courts. The Supreme Court’s recent ruling in Loper Bright Enterprises v. Raimondo makes clear that regulators cannot expand their power through regulation, and that is exactly what this proposed rule would do.

In a recent one press releasethe CFTC said it proposed the change to specify the types of contracts covered by the Commodity Exchange Act (CEA) as a means of protecting the public’s interests. The proposal examines event contracts involving “gaming” as activities considered unlawful under federal or state law.

According to the CFTC, gaming includes event contracts that wager on the outcome of a political contest, sweepstakes and athletic competition.
